This will be an action packed historic event where two Grandmasters will train you, with participants having lunch provided and afterwards a cook out where all participants can enjoy comradely in the martial arts and hang out around the bond fire! Which is all included in the seminar costs!
Professor Gary Dill will train you in the dynamic trapping in Jeet Kune Do, then taking the Jeet Kune Do trapping skills; Grandmaster Barry Rodemaker will train you in devastating Hapkido joint destruction and Hapkido’s brutal takedowns!
This event is open to all martial artists!
Grandmaster Professor Gary Dill, who has the rare honor of being one of the few original students who trained in Bruce Lee's Oakland branch school while Bruce Lee was still alive and one of the few students of James Lee who was asked to carry on the knowledge of Jeet Kune Do.
Grandmaster Barry Rodemaker has been inducted in 12 Martial Arts Hall of Fames and holds multiple 8th black belt ranks in several organizations. And is the founder of the Tactical Hapkido Alliance, officially registered by the International Black Belt Organization.
